Transaction bb8da66242cc69f0df4149ac27a510bcd096f9b7f41eeb7278007859909ac3d9
1 Input
1 Output
-
bb8da66242cc69f0df4149ac27a510bcd096f9b7f41eeb7278007859909ac3d9:0
- value
- 102577632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e184a4a2b71a1dd1151c48766b63055faf46438b OP_EQUAL
- address
- 3NFSrukWSfxXAKWruunzojV5Tob9i6txjT